imToken 2.0 钱包私钥碰撞详解及其影响分析
数字货币的快速发展推动了区块链技术的普及,使得数字钱包成为了用户存储和管理加密资产的重要工具。在众多数字钱包中,imToken 是一款较为知名的数字钱包应用,其2.0版本引入了多项新特性,包括更友好的用户界面和增强的安全性。然而,随着安全性需求的增加,私钥碰撞这一话题开始引起广泛关注。本文将深入探讨 imToken 2.0 钱包的私钥碰撞问题,分析其潜在影响以及如何应对这一安全威胁。
什么是私钥碰撞?
私钥碰撞是指两个不同的公钥生成相同的私钥。由于区块链的安全性主要依赖于密码学,私钥与公钥之间存在一一对应关系。每个私钥都能生成一个唯一的公钥,而公钥又可以用来生成对应的链上地址。在理论上,私钥碰撞意味着可以有多个用户或实体通过不同的方式生成相同的私钥,导致对同一资产的控制权可能被多个用户拥有。
在实际操作中,私钥碰撞的机会极为渺小,由于私钥是基于复杂算法生成的,理论上可生成的私钥总数非常庞大。然而,随着量子计算等新兴技术的发展,私钥碰撞的安全性问题引起了越来越多技术人员和使用者的关注。即使在我们现在的加密环境下,了解这一问题的本质及其影响也是至关重要的。
imToken 2.0 钱包私钥碰撞的可能性
imToken 2.0 钱包作为一种普遍使用的数字资产管理工具,其私钥生成机制采用了高强度的加密算法。在理论上,任何现代加密算法都应能避免私钥碰撞。但在特定情况下,比如算法实施不当、使用弱密码或受到特殊攻击时,私钥碰撞的风险会显著增加。
此外,imToken 2.0 钱包也可能面临其他形式的攻击,比如社交工程,则可能会使攻击者获得用户的私钥。一个合乎逻辑的推论是,如果用户的不当操作导致私钥泄露,即便没有真正的碰撞,攻击者也能通过其他方式控制用户资产。因此,虽然私钥碰撞的实际发生可能性较小,依旧需要用户对钱包的使用保持警惕,以防止潜在的安全威胁。
私钥碰撞的后果
如果私钥发生碰撞,可能导致资产管理混乱,甚至受到经济损失。具体后果有以下几个方面:
- 资产丢失:如果两个用户共享了同一个私钥,那么其中一个用户的交易可能会影响到另一个用户的资产转移。在最坏的情况下,攻击者可能会利用这一现象进行盗窃或欺诈,导致资产损失。
- 信任危机:区块链的安全性是构建在去中心化和透明性基础上的,若私钥碰撞现象越来越频繁,这将引发用户对数字钱包的信任危机,使得用户对数字货币的整体态度变得消极。
- 合规和法律责任:如果因私钥碰撞导致了资金损失,可能会引发法律纠纷,无论是针对钱包开发商还是用户之间。合规的问题将可能导致钱包在监管上的不可持续性。
- 技术挑战:私钥碰撞既是技术上的问题,也是产品迭代中的课题。如果处理不当,可能严重妨碍产品的进一步发展。
如何减少私钥碰撞风险?
为了减少私钥碰撞的风险,用户和开发者可以采取以下措施:
- 使用强密码:私钥的安全性与生成私钥时所使用的随机性和复杂性密切相关,使用强密码(包含字母、数字、符号)可以减少被攻击的风险。
- 定期更新私钥:定期更新与数字资产相关的私钥,特别是在怀疑私钥可能泄露时,可以有效降低安全隐患。
- 多种安全验证方式:用户可以选择启用多种验证方式,比如双因素身份验证(2FA),以进一步提高安全性。
- 及时关注安全更新:钱包开发商会定期推出安全补丁和更新,及时升级钱包版本以防止已知的安全问题。
未来趋势及可能的解决方案
随着技术的发展,私钥碰撞的问题将会越来越引起注意。未来可能出现的解决方案包括:
- 量子密码学:量子计算有潜力改变密码学的格局,量子密码学可能成为未来私钥生成的新标准,从而大幅减少碰撞的可能性。
- 多签名钱包:通过多签名机制,一笔交易需要多个私钥共同授权,可以有效避免单个私钥发生碰撞所带来的风险。
- 分层确定性钱包(HD Wallet):HD Wallet 生成的私钥会有一个主私钥和多个衍生私钥,这虽然不能完全避免碰撞的问题,但可以有效降低它们在同一环境中冲突的概率。
可能相关的问题
1. 私钥碰撞与纸钱包的安全性有何关系?
私钥碰撞不仅仅是数字钱包中的一个问题,纸钱包作为一种离线存储形式,理论上其私钥生成方式也是一样的。但由于纸钱包的生成过程容易受到人为因素影响,如果生成步骤不当,则可能产生碰撞。此外,纸钱包一旦丢失或受到损坏,资产将无法恢复。因此,用户在选择纸钱包时,也应该遵循强密码和安全生成原则。
2. imToken 2.0 钱包的安全特性有哪些?
imToken 2.0 钱包具备多种安全特性,如多签名机制、冷存储支持、私钥本地管理等。这些功能能有效降低私钥碰撞和其他安全隐患。同时,用户可通过多重身份验证和更新机制提升安全性,减少事故发生的可能。
3. 如何恢复被盗或丢失的私钥?
一旦私钥丢失或被盗,恢复的可能性几乎为零。这也正是为什么保护私钥至关重要。建议用户在创建钱包是妥善记录私钥,并考虑将其保存在离线或冷存储的环境中。如果必须使用在线钱包,尽量使用一些带有备份和恢复机制的钱包。
4. 遇到资产丢失时如何处理?
如果因私钥碰撞或其他原因导致资产丢失,首先要保持冷静。针对可能的诈骗行为,用户应联系相关钱包的客户支持进行求助。同时,可以向法律机构进行咨询,以了解是否可以采取法律措施进行追讨。最重要的是,保持警惕,防止再度发生这样的事件。
总结来说,尽管私钥碰撞在 imToken 2.0 钱包等数字资产管理工具中发生的几率很小,但随着技术的不断进步,这一问题仍需各方共同重视和预防。用户应了解安全威胁并采取相应的防范措施,钱包开发者同样需提升安全保障,确保用户资产的安全。